Output 7c8abdb60de60ec3ed930e532cae23951fe6865a14101780e79a0b6174ed1b10:1

value
16823602
script pubkey
OP_0 OP_PUSHBYTES_20 fc98fe9230a43172b827a2262480f780a568ccca
address
bc1qljv0ay3s5sch9wp85gnzfq8hszjk3nx2e7fpm5
transaction
7c8abdb60de60ec3ed930e532cae23951fe6865a14101780e79a0b6174ed1b10
confirmations
112633
spent
true